    I respectfully disagree with the author. What killer features is he expecting at this point? The revolutions happened earlier, eg Windows 3.0, Windows 95, Xp and 7, and now the OS is more mature. In fact I wish Microsoft would stop trying to add features to Windows 10 that require major OS updates with all the risks and inconvenience that entails. Microsoft used to have some nice apps for people who wanted to add features, such as Digital Image Pro and Streets & Trips; I feel that was a better option :)
